Regarding the responses given by the Rio de Janeiro Football Federation to the pertinent questions regarding the entity's 2014 Balance Sheet, CR Flamengo publicly regrets that, instead of providing clear and objective answers to the requested information, FERJ has chosen to confuse matters and evade its obligation, even reproducing an accusatory and completely factually unsubstantiated rhetoric repeatedly delivered by the political faction defeated in CR Flamengo's last presidential election. This crude rhetoric contrasts public funding with the failure to pay taxes due, in other words, praising the club's tax evasion, so commonly practiced in the past. This is yet another regrettable demonstration of the disrespectful treatment CR Flamengo has received from FERJ.
 
Furthermore, FERJ's evasive responses were compounded by base and unjustified accusations, attempting to position CR Flamengo as antagonistic to the organization's other affiliates. Flamengo takes this opportunity to make it clear that it believes that clubs such as Colônia Juliano Moreira Atlético Clube, Associação Esportiva Piscinão de Ramos, and Liga Varre-Saiense de Desportos play a significant social role in their communities. It simply doesn't see any point in them playing a significant role in the Rio de Janeiro Football Championship and the election of FERJ officials. 
 
Returning to the questions themselves, unfortunately, what we imagined when we asked them was confirmed: there was no satisfactory response. Not even the fundamental points were addressed. Namely: 

1. Which clubs are in debt to the Federation? 
2. How much is owed by each club?
3. What are the payment deadlines?
4. Are there any clubs in arrears?
5. In addition to these amounts, has the entity been a guarantor for any loans from third parties, especially football clubs?

In other words, they all remain shrouded in suspicious opacity. And, therefore, they will continue to be questioned.

CR Flamengo, like the people of Rio de Janeiro, has the right to know in detail each transaction recorded in the balance sheet before approving it. And it understands that FERJ, in the name of transparency and good administrative practices, has the duty to provide such information to all who request it.
